Keith Haring
Growing I

1987

About the Item

Artist: Keith Haring Title: Growing I Size: 40 1/8 x 29 7/8 in. (101.9 x 75.9 cm) Medium: Screenprint in colors, on Lenox Museum Board, with full margins. Edition: 85 of 100 Year: 1987 Notes: Image Size: 38 3/4 x 28 3/4 in. (98.4 x 73 cm) Signed, dated and numbered 85/100 in pencil (there were also 15 artist's proofs), published by Martin Lawrence Limited Editions, New York (with their inkstamp on the reverse), framed in Plexi Box. Klaus Littmann p. 89.
